Transaction 80dc4cb82eedac046b19e580476f71850ebdf84d94becc97425eecff9ed439a2
1 Input
1 Output
-
80dc4cb82eedac046b19e580476f71850ebdf84d94becc97425eecff9ed439a2:0
- value
- 29990960
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 89055df0ac2674dab6ca073c48158f219a0cf8a3 OP_EQUAL
- address
- 3EBWvj7sMMZFVe16LidhPXRjCv8Jb7km4o